简介:本文将为读者详细解读ShardingSphere 5.3系列在Spring框架下的配置升级要点,包括配置文件的变更、依赖的调整以及实践中的注意事项,帮助读者顺利完成升级过程。
ShardingSphere 5.3 升级指南:Spring 配置篇
随着ShardingSphere 5.3版本的发布,其强大的分布式数据库解决方案再次引起了业界的广泛关注。对于已经在使用ShardingSphere的早期版本并且基于Spring框架进行开发的用户来说,升级到5.3版本可能会面临一些配置上的挑战。本文将为大家提供一份详尽的升级指南,帮助大家顺利完成这一过渡。
一、升级前的准备工作
在升级之前,请确保您已经详细了解了ShardingSphere 5.3版本的更新内容、变更点以及新特性。这有助于您在升级过程中更加明确需要进行的配置调整。
二、配置文件变更
在ShardingSphere 5.3中,schema.yaml的配置结构发生了一些变化。例如,数据源的配置方式更加灵活,支持多种数据源类型,如JDBC、JPA等。同时,分片策略、读写分离等配置也有所调整,需要您根据新版本的要求进行相应的修改。
server.yaml主要用于配置ShardingSphere的治理中心。在5.3版本中,治理中心的配置也有所调整,如增加了对多数据源的支持、优化了性能监控等。请根据实际需求进行相应的配置调整。
三、依赖调整
在升级过程中,您可能需要调整项目中的依赖版本。请确保您已经将ShardingSphere的依赖版本更新为5.3,并检查其他相关依赖是否与新版本兼容。
四、实践中的注意事项
在进行升级之前,请务必备份原有的配置文件和数据库数据,以防止升级过程中出现问题导致数据丢失。
建议在生产环境中采用逐步升级的方式,先将部分业务升级到新版本,观察运行情况,确保无误后再进行全面升级。
升级完成后,请进行全面的测试验证,包括单元测试、集成测试以及性能测试等,确保新版本能够满足业务需求。
ShardingSphere社区非常活跃,经常会有新的修复和更新。在升级过程中,请保持关注社区动态,及时获取最新的升级指导和解决方案。
五、总结
通过本文的解读,相信您对ShardingSphere 5.3版本的Spring配置升级已经有了更清晰的认识。在实际操作过程中,如果遇到任何问题,请及时查阅官方文档或向社区寻求帮助。祝您升级顺利!
附录
[请在此处添加附录]